CK started off his career with Citi where he handled business development and sales for its private banking group. After Citi, he accepted a position in BDO Capital's investment banking group where he covered the consumer, retail, and technology sectors and helped his clients execute growth strategies. His work entailed him to lead cross-functional teams and perform data analysis, modeling, and valuation, which served as the basis for multi-billion dollar acquisitions and divestitures. Between his first and second year in business school, he worked at Blockchain, where he did strategy and business development work to help launch the company's digital wallet product in new markets. He then worked for Route 66 Ventures and covered the FinTech sector out of New York City. In 2017, he was hired to lead the Kraft Heinz Company's Thailand and the Philippines business units, which products he helped grow to market leaders in the sauce and dairy categories. He currently works as Co-Managing Director at his family office, Wong Chu King, Holdings Inc. In 2021, he launched his passion project called Grove Street Roasters.
